Course Lessons
Lesson 1. From Atoms to Circuits: Understanding the Fundamentals of Electricity
The course begins with a dive into foundational electrical theory concepts crucial for understanding electronics, emphasizing electric force, charge distinctions, and atomic structure. By mastering the behavior of conductors and insulators in electric circuits, you will develop a solid grounding for more complex electronic studies.Lesson 2. Understanding Voltage and Current
Voltage and current are demystified as essential concepts in electrical theory, with voltage likened to potential energy differences observable in devices like batteries, while current is clarified as the quantifiable flow of charge akin to movement in a wire. The lesson explains how these concepts are interconnected and sets a foundation for more advanced discussions in electronics.Lesson 3. Navigating the World of Simple Electrical Circuits
Power supplies convert various energy forms into electrical energy, crucial for creating circuits that guide currents to perform tasks like heating and illumination. A switch in a circuit controls the flow of current, turning devices on or off by forming open or closed loops.Lesson 4. Harnessing Electrical Resistance: A Deep Dive into Resistor Circuits and Ohm's Law
We delve into the concept of resistance in resistor circuits, where Ohm's law helps to quantify the relationship between voltage, current, and resistance. Through gravitational analogies, we illustrate how resistors impede charge flow, resulting in heat production.Lesson 5. Exploring the World of Resistor Networks
This lesson introduces resistor networks, analyzing how resistors behave in parallel and series arrangements. Emphasizing the importance of equal voltage drop across parallel resistors and consistent current through series resistors, it provides foundations for more complex circuit analysis.Lesson 6. Demystifying Capacitors: An Introductory Journey into Charge Storage
A capacitor consists of two plates separated by an insulator and can store charge when connected to a power source, acting as a short-term energy reserve in circuits. This lesson covers basic capacitor functionality, including how charge accumulates and discharges, as well as its significance in generating time-variant voltages.Lesson 7. Exploring the Fundamentals of Magnetism and Its Role in Electric Circuits
Examination of magnetism within electric circuits reveals its basis in electric charge and motion, creating magnetic fields that affect wire loops, crucial for transformers and other devices. Induction, where a varying magnetic field produces current through a loop, is highlighted as essential for powering homes and industries.Lesson 8. A Dive into Electromagnetic Energy with Inductors
Lesson 8 introduces the inductor, a key electrical circuit component that, like a capacitor, stores energy but does so in a magnetic field. The lesson highlights the role of inductors in circuits, emphasizing their unique characteristics and applications in communications and transformers.Lesson 9. Hands-On with Electronic Circuits
Efficient electronic circuit construction involves prototyping on solderless boards and circuit testing with multimeters. Engaging with this process, the lesson offers insights into the gradual development from computer-modeled ideas to real-world printed circuit board setups.Lesson 10. The Quantum World of Semiconductors
This lesson delves into semiconductors, materials key to building diodes and transistors, foundational in all electronic gadgets. Semiconductor chips, now miniaturized into integrated circuits, allow for the complex functioning of contemporary electronic devices.Lesson 11. The Art of Electrical Transformation
A transformer's efficiency lies in its ability to alter voltage through magnetic induction, leveraging principles of AC power. This process ensures optimal conversion of high-voltage supply to suit domestic needs without generating additional power.Lesson 12. Simplicity in Signals: Unraveling Basic Communication Circuits
An exploration of basic communication circuits, this lesson underscores the importance of capacitors and inductors in the wireless signal processing. It also demystifies how antennas function and how circuits can tune to specific frequencies.
Learning Outcomes
- Identify and differentiate between positive and negative electric charges by examining their behaviors in attracting or repelling forces.
- Recognize and describe the basic atomic structure, including protons, neutrons, and electrons, and their roles in electrical properties.
- Calculate the current by determining the number of coulombs passing through a point per second in an electrical circuit.
- Define voltage as the amount of potential energy per coulomb of charge between two points in an electric field.
- Analyze a simple electrical circuit and determine the direction of current flow based on the orientation of the power supply terminals
- Recognize the function and representation of a simple power supply in electrical circuits by identifying its positive and negative terminals
- Apply Ohm's Law to calculate and analyze voltage, current, and resistance in simple resistor circuits.
- Define resistance and explain its effect on current flow in a circuit, using resistors as an example.
- Analyze the total current flow in circuits with two resistors in series.
- Identify the voltage drop across resistors arranged in parallel using Ohm's law.
- Analyze simple circuits containing capacitors by calculating the charge stored based on capacitance and voltage using the formula Q = CV
- Recognize the function of a capacitor by describing its ability to store electrical energy as a function of capacitance and voltage
- Identify and describe the relationship between electric current and magnetism, providing examples of their interaction in wire loops.
